Tennova North Knoxville Medical Center is seeking a BE/BC Internal Medicine Physician to join our Internal Medicine Residency Continuity Clinic team working with and teaching residents.
Overview
- Full-time hospital employed position
- 100% outpatient setting
- Serve as a clinical preceptor, supervising and mentoring Internal Medicine residents in their continuity clinic
- Guide residents in evidence-based patient care, professional development, and practice management
- Supervise residents in their documentation in the EMR, writing of orders, and articulation of care plans by reviewing resident notes and adding the appropriate addendums
- Provide two didactic lectures per year
- Complete annual evaluations
- Work in a collaborative, team-based academic environment with opportunities for scholarly activities
Qualifications
- Board-certified in the United States
- Must have completed residency in the United States
- A strong interest in teaching residents in an academic clinical setting

About Community Health Systems
Community Health Systems, Inc. (CHS) is one of the nation’s leading healthcare providers. Developing and operating healthcare delivery systems in 36 distinct markets across 14 states, CHS is committed to helping people get well and live healthier. CHS operates 60+ acute-care hospitals and more than 1,000 other sites of care, including physician practices, urgent care centers, freestanding emergency departments, occupational medicine clinics, imaging centers, cancer centers and ambulatory surgery centers.
